­

MySQL-5.7.29解压版安装教程【全网最新】

作者:北顾箫
博客园地址://www.cnblogs.com/Aarom

1.下载解压

下载地址://downloads.mysql.com/archives/community/

  • 选择与系统对应位数下载,我这里选择的是64位(下载会稍微有点慢)

  • 解压:例如我解压目录为 D:\Config\mysql-5.7.29-winx64

2. 配置环境变量

  • win+i打开Windows设置👉系统👉关于👉高级系统设置👉环境变量👉系统变量

  • 这里有两种方式:

  • 第一种:

    1.新建MYSQL_HOME变量

    变量名:MYSQL_HOME
    变量值:D:\Config\mysql-5.7.29-winx64    // 要根据自己的实际路径配置
    

    2.在Path变量中添加

    %MYSQL_HOME%\bin
    

  • 第二种:

    1.直接在Path变量中添加

    D:\Config\mysql-5.7.29-winx64\bin
    

  • 任意选择一种方式,确认无误后一直点确认

  • 我用的是第二种,较为简单

3. 初始化

  • 在D:\Config\mysql-5.7.29-winx64目录新建一个文本文档

  • 把以下数据复制进去,保存后重命名为my.ini

    # 设置mysql客户端默认字符集
    
    default-character-set=utf8
    
    [mysqld]
    
    # 设置3306端口
    
    port = 3306
    
    # 设置mysql的安装目录
    
    basedir=D:\Config\mysql-5.7.29-winx64
    
    # 设置 mysql数据库的数据的存放目录,MySQL 8+ 不需要以下配置,系统自己生成即可,否则有可能报错
    
    datadir=D:\Config\mysql-5.7.29-winx64\data
    
    # 允许最大连接数
    
    max_connections=20
    
    # 服务端使用的字符集默认utf8
    
    character-set-server=utf8
    
    # 创建新表时将使用的默认存储引擎
    
    default-storage-engine=INNODB
    

  • 管理员身份运行命令提示符(这里一定要管理员身份运行)

  • 初始化mysql:输入mysqld --initialize-insecure,回车,当目录中出现data文件夹进行下一步

  • 注册mysql服务:输入mysqld -install,回车

  • 启动mysql服务:输入net start mysql,回车。

  • 初始化密码:敲入mysqladmin -u root password 你想要设置的密码

  • 以后改密码用:mysqladmin -u用户名 -p旧密码 password 新密码

  • 启动mysql服务:输入mysql -u root -p,回车,输入密码,再回车

4.卸载方法

  • 先停止mysql服务:net stop mysql,回车
  • 再卸载:mysqld -remove mysql,回车
  • 最后删除环境变量即可

转载请注明出处://www.cnblogs.com/Aarom/p/15987655.html
恶意转载必究!!!